The Collected Stories of F. Scott Fitzgerald
The Collected Stories by F. Scott Fitzgerald is a stunning anthology that showcases the brilliant short fiction of one of America's greatest literary voices. Known for his keen observations of the Jazz Age and the complexities of the American Dream, Fitzgerald's stories are rich with themes of love, wealth, disillusionment, and the passage of time. Each story in this collection reflects his masterful ability to capture the fleeting beauty of life, the fragility of human relationships, and the often-painful truths beneath the surface of society's glittering facade. The Collected Stories offers readers a profound and timeless journey through Fitzgerald's world, making it an essential read for anyone fascinated by the complexities of the human condition and the allure of 20th-century America.

About the Author

About The Author

Author of the widely lauded novel The Great Gatsby, as well as This Side of Paradise, The Beautiful and the Damned, and Tender is the Night, F. Scott Fitzgerald is best known for chronicling the excesses and tribulations of the Jazz Age. One of the leading authors of the post-World War I "Lost Generation," Fitzgerald often invokes themes of youth, beauty, and despair in his books and short stories. He was also known for his hard-partying lifestyle, as well as his marriage to the beautiful yet troubled Zelda Fitzgerald.

Date of Birth:

September 24, 1896

Date of Death:

December 21, 1940

Place of Birth:

St. Paul, Minnesota

Education:

Princeton University
